1. Step 1

Heat oil in a hot pan, the oil must be 8-9 parts hot before adding eggs to fix the shape. If the oil is not hot enough, the egg liquid cannot solidify quickly, resulting in a large egg area and no texture.
2. Step 2

When the egg white changes, sprinkle a suitable amount of salt evenly on the egg.
3. Step 3

After sprinkling salt, quickly flip and fry for a moment.
4. Step 4

Continue to flip over and sprinkle pepper powder on the side with egg yolk, then it can be taken out of the pan.
5. Step 5

Take it out of the pan, it’s a finished product.
